1.3.3 Insert Mode
The key bindings in this mode is the same as in the emacs mode
except for the following 4 keys. So, you can move around in the
buffer and change its content while you are in insert mode.
- <ESC>
-
This key will take you back to vi mode.
- C-h
-
Delete previous character.
- C-w
-
Delete previous word.
- C-z
-
Typing this key has the same effect as typing <ESC>
in emacs mode. Thus typing C-z x in insert mode will
have the same effect as typing ESC x in emacs
mode.
